Can I turn on my airpump when I have baby glofish in the tank?


For pretty much any type of fish fry, a sponge filter is recommended (which is run by an air pump.) Glowfish need oxygenated water just like other danios. ;) If the fry are newborns, you'll want to keep the airflow on the low side until they grow some and can handle the current. You can regulate the flow with a gang valve.
